Chief Executive Officer (CEO)

88006 Socorro, New Mexico Community Health Systems

Posted 7 days ago

Job Viewed

Tap Again To Close

Job Description

**_MountainView Regional Medical Center_** is your community healthcare provider. This 168-bed facility, accredited by The Joint Commission, provides a broad range of healthcare services, including inpatient and outpatient care, diagnostic imaging ( and emergency ( , medical and surgical care ( . From spine surgery ( , minimally invasive robotic surgery ( and open-heart surgery to access to preventive and primary care ( through our integrated delivery system, we strive to offer quality medical care to our friends and neighbors throughout Southern New Mexico. As an accredited Chest Pain Center, ( an accredited Joint Replacement Center and an accredited Stroke Center, we are committed to offering nationally recognized care. With more than 1200 employees and nearly 250 physicians on staff representing more than 50 medical specialties, we work hard every day to be a place of healing, caring and connection for patients and families in the community we call home.
**Job Summary**
The Chief Executive Officer (CEO) is responsible for providing leadership and oversight of all hospital and/or health system operations. The CEO ensures the success of the hospital through quality enhancement, cost containment, revenue growth, and the development of strong relationships with hospital staff, board members, and community leaders. This role provides strategic direction, financial oversight, and operational leadership to drive efficiency, optimize patient care, and ensure regulatory compliance. The CEO collaborates with corporate leadership, physicians, and key stakeholders to implement policies, improve hospital performance, and support long-term growth initiatives.
**Essential Functions**
+ Oversees hospital operations to ensure high-quality, efficient, and cost-effective patient care while meeting strategic and financial objectives.
+ Develops and implements hospital policies, procedures, and long-term strategic plans in collaboration with system leadership.
+ Provides leadership to hospital managers, directors, and officers to promote engagement, ownership of goals, and participation in decision-making.
+ Ensures compliance with regulatory and accreditation requirements, working closely with the Chief Nursing Officer and other leaders to maintain quality and safety standards.
+ Builds and maintains strong relationships with physicians, taking a leadership role in physician recruitment and retention to support service line growth and patient care.
+ Identifies cost-saving opportunities, working with the Chief Financial Officer and Chief Nursing Officer to eliminate non-value-added expenses while maintaining operational excellence.
+ Represents the hospital at board meetings, medical staff meetings, and community engagements, strengthening relationships with stakeholders and enhancing the hospital's presence in the community.
+ Participates in monthly operational reviews and system-level meetings to monitor hospital performance and ensure alignment with corporate goals.
+ Monitors changes in healthcare policies, regulations, and market trends to anticipate challenges and develop strategies for financial and operational success.
+ Oversees leadership development programs and mentors emerging healthcare leaders to foster a culture of professional growth and succession planning.
+ Promotes the hospital's mission and vision, ensuring alignment with community needs and regulatory expectations.
+ Leads initiatives to measure and improve quality, patient satisfaction, and service excellence.
+ Ensures hospital services align with the needs of the community while maintaining high standards of patient care.
+ Collaborates with hospital leadership, including CFOs and CNOs, to develop and execute financial and operational strategies that drive revenue growth and cost management.
+ Works closely with corporate senior leadership, providing updates on hospital performance, financial metrics, and key initiatives.
+ Ensures achievement of short- and long-term financial and operational goals, aligning with corporate and regional objectives.
+ Leads performance improvement initiatives by analyzing operational data and identifying areas for enhancement.
+ Performs other duties as assigned.
+ Complies with all policies and standards.
**Qualifications**
+ Master's Degree in Hospital Administration, Business Administration, or related field required
+ More than 10 years of progressive leadership experience in healthcare administration required
+ 5-7 years in an executive or senior leadership role required
**Knowledge, Skills and Abilities**
+ Extensive knowledge of hospital operations, healthcare regulations, and financial management principles.
+ Strong strategic planning and leadership skills to drive operational excellence and growth.
+ Ability to collaborate effectively with physicians, healthcare teams, board members, and external stakeholders.
+ Strong financial acumen, including budgeting, revenue cycle management, and cost control strategies.
+ Exceptional communication and interpersonal skills to engage staff, foster teamwork, and build strong partnerships.
+ Experience with performance improvement initiatives and data-driven decision-making to enhance hospital efficiency and patient care.
+ Ability to analyze market trends, anticipate challenges, and develop innovative solutions for organizational success.
+ Knowledge of accreditation standards, compliance requirements, and best practices in hospital administration.

CEO / Chief Executive Officer

Montana, Montana Quantum People

Posted 2 days ago

Job Viewed

Tap Again To Close

Job Description


Chief Executive Officer Advanced Photonics & Quantum Manufacturing

Are you a visionary leader with a passion for advanced technology and a track record of driving growth and innovation? A newly acquired, high-tech manufacturing company at the forefront of photonics and quantum applications is seeking a dynamic Chief Executive Officer (CEO) to lead its next phase of transformation and expansion.

This company, now part of a growing international group, has built a strong reputation for excellence in optical component manufacturing , serving sectors such as defence, aerospace, scientific instrumentation , and quantum technologies . With a rich history of R&D collaboration with world-leading institutions, the business is poised for significant growth and evolution.

This is a rare opportunity to lead a company with a strong foundation and global growth potential.  You will be part of a forward-thinking group committed to innovation, collaboration, and making a real impact in the work of photonics and quantum technologies.

The role is ideally positioned for an existing CEO or an ambitious COO, General manager or managing Director looking to step up into a CEO role.


Location & Working Style
  • Primary Location : Montana
  • Working Model : Hybrid (approx. 75% on-site once familiar with operations)
  • Hours : Full-time, 40 hours/week
Role Overview

As CEO, you will lead the company through a period of strategic change, integrating it into a broader group structure while enhancing operational excellence and commercial performance. You will be responsible for P&L management , strategic planning , and commercial leadership across North American operations, with a strong focus on product development, delivery, and profitability.

This is a hands-on leadership role in a technology-rich environment , ideal for someone who thrives on innovation, transformation, and building high-performing teams.

Key Responsibilities
  • Develop and execute strategic plans to drive growth and profitability
  • Lead integration and change management initiatives across the business
  • Oversee daily operations, product development, and delivery
  • Manage financial performance including budgeting, forecasting, and reporting
  • Foster a culture of innovation, collaboration, and continuous improvement
  • Build and mentor a senior leadership team aligned with group values
  • Represent the company to key stakeholders, partners, and customers
  • Collaborate with group leadership to shape broader commercial strategy
Candidate Profile

Were looking for a seasoned executive with:

  • 5+ years in senior leadership within advanced manufacturing, photonics, or quantum-related industries
  • Proven success in business strategy, financial management , and team leadership
  • Strong commercial acumen and experience with product development and market introduction
  • Excellent communication and stakeholder engagement skills
  • A relevant technical degree (e.g., Physics, Optics, Materials Science)
  • Proficiency in business systems (MRP, CRM, financial software)
Desirable Experience
  • M&A integration and scaling of acquired businesses
  • Background in quantum science applications
  • Familiarity with US Government innovation programs (SBIR, STTR)
  • Experience in defence-related program delivery
  • Knowledge of nonlinear optical materials (e.g., PPLN/PPKTP)
  • Multilingual capabilities (German, French, Spanish, or Chinese)
  • Postgraduate qualifications

CEO

Michigan, North Dakota Salt Creek Capital

Posted today

Job Viewed

Tap Again To Close

Job Description

Salt Creek Capital is seeking an experienced operating executive to join the firm as an Executive Partner. The executive is expected to work with the firm to evaluate acquisition opportunities of companies which they would oversee as President & CEO post-close. As CEO, the executive will be required to manage the full P&L, develop the growth strategy, and provide operational management. CEOs of companies acquired by SCC serve as the most senior business executive at the company, and report to & participate on the Company’s board of directors.

Qualifications:

  • At least 10 years of senior management experience; prior successful P&L management and/or President or GM experience required
  • Desire to participate as a business partner and ability to balance fiduciary responsibilities to numerous disparate stakeholders
  • Proven experience, ability, and desire to manage a business with focus on generating strong free cash flow / EBITDA
  • Entrepreneurial thinker with an appetite to take on a high level of responsibility commensurate with anticipated rewards
  • Proven ability to manage all aspects of a company
  • Demonstrated ability to increase profitability through proactive business development efforts
  • Excellent professional references and high integrity
